你查询的IP:[123.56.80.116]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询116.52.234.62 123.101.41.133 116.16.37.196 116.112.223.2 124.64.58.177 221.14.226.94 117.75.134.1 134.196.149.126 211.80.205.203 123.56.80.116 202.136.48.149 58.99.128.83 222.128.141.190 221.199.192.201 202.38.205.127 123.100.169.177 203.175.192.148 59.107.161.13 118.239.175.234 58.87.64.177 59.172.82.65 210.52.136.22 161.207.76.85 118.84.69.186 202.90.252.248 125.98.120.217 122.156.151.116 202.127.40.49 59.107.226.156 118.88.32.168 123.56.150.87